The Fourcroft looks spectacularly over the old fishing harbour and across Carmarthen Bay. Fourcroft forms part of a Listed Georgian terrace, built over 150 years ago as individual summer houses.

Over the fifty years and three generations of family ownership, Fourcroft has been consistently upgraded to become one of Tenby`s most luxurious hotels.

Most of our 40 bedrooms overlook the bay. All of them offer an extensive range of facilities to ensure your comfort: ensuite bathroom, radio and T.V., central heating, tea and coffee bar, hair dryer, direct dial telephone. A lift runs from the first half landing.

Our restaurant (Ossie Morgan`s) and lounges also overlook the sea. All our food, featuring local produce, is freshly prepared by skilled chefs familiar with a seaside appetite.
